Replacing Your Social Security Card Online Explained

Need a replacement for your Social Security card? The process has become incredibly convenient, and you can now handle it entirely online. First visiting the official Social Security Administration (SSA) website at www.ssa.gov. From there, discover the section dedicated to replacing lost or damaged cards. You'll need to create an account if you haven't already. Next, provide your personal information and submit your application. The SSA will review your request and process it within a few weeks. You'll receive confirmation when your new card is ready.

  • Keep in mind: You can also request a replacement card by phone or mail, but the online process is generally quicker.

Can You Safely Apply for a Social Security Card Online?

Applying for a Social Security card online provides a convenient alternative to traditional methods, but it's important to understand the security aspects involved. The Social Security Administration (SSA) implements strict safeguards to protect your information during the application process. When applying online, ensure you're on the official SSA website and use a secure connection. Examine the site's security measures and be wary of phishing attempts that may try to steal your data.

  • Always double-check the URL before entering any sensitive information.
  • Use strong passwords and multi-factor authentication whenever possible.
By taking these precautions, you can reduce the risks and safely apply for a Social Security card online.
